随着JavaScript环境的日益多样化,开发者对于高性能且兼容性强的运行时需求不断提升。Bun作为一款新兴的JavaScript运行时环境,凭借其惊人的性能和创新的架构设计,正在迅速赢得社区关注。近期,Bun在Node.js的事件模块(events)测试中实现了100%的通过率,这一成就不仅彰显了Bun对Node.js核心功能的高度兼容性,同时也为开发者带来了更多选择和可能。事件模块是Node.js生态系统中不可或缺的组成部分,它负责处理事件的注册与触发机制,广泛应用于异步编程和事件驱动架构中。事件模块的稳定性和可靠性直接影响着Node.js应用的运行效率和用户体验。Bun实现对该模块全面兼容,表明其在保持现有JavaScript标准的同时,能够无缝衔接大量基于Node.js构建的项目。
通过对Node.js事件模块测试的全面通过,Bun展现出了其对事件模型深刻理解及高质量实现的能力。这一兼容性优势使得开发者能够在Bun环境中放心运行已有的基于事件模块的代码,无需投入大量时间重构或调试,极大地降低了迁移成本。Bun的架构设计采用了现代编译技术和底层优化策略,能够提供比传统Node.js环境更快的执行速度和更低的资源占用。事件模块的高效实现,既提升了事件监听和触发的响应速度,也减少了内存和CPU的消耗,这对于高并发的服务器端应用尤为关键。此外,Bun对事件模块的完美适配,强化了其作为完整Node.js替代方案的竞争力。开发者在构建实时通信、流处理以及微服务架构时,通常依赖事件驱动机制。
Bun能够无缝支持这些场景,不仅保证了代码的稳定性,也优化了性能表现,为企业级应用提供了坚实基础。实现事件模块100%测试通过的背后,是Bun团队持续不断的技术积累和社区合作。通过开放源代码和积极响应社区反馈,Bun不断完善自身的兼容层,实现对Node.js核心API的精准复刻。未来,随着更多模块和API的逐步适配,Bun有望成为一个全面可信赖的JavaScript运行时。对于开发者来说,选择Bun意味着既能享受极致的执行效率,也能保护现有投资,轻松实现迁移和升级。事件模块作为Node.js生态的重要环节兼容性的提升,为Bun赢得了良好的口碑和市场认可。
综上所述,Bun在Node.js事件模块测试中实现100%通过,不仅证明其核心技术实力,也为整个JavaScript生态注入了新的活力。在未来多样化的应用场景下,Bun有望成为推动Node.js技术进步的重要力量,助力开发者打造更加高效、稳定的现代应用。